Rippe Lavalet
Rippe Lavalet is a deciduous forest in Vescours, Arrondissement of Bourg-en-Bresse,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es. Rippe Lavalet is situated nearby to the hamlet Locel, as well as near Petit Crève.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Romenay
Village
Photo: Chabe01,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Romenay is a commune in the Saône-et-Loire department in the region of Bourgogne-Franche-Comté in eastern France. It is a pretty medieval town surrounded by ancient walls with its typical church at the centre of town.
